Moreover, VR can be a powerful tool for visualizing ideas and concepts that are difficult or impossible to represent through traditional means. Architects can use VR to create immersive models of their designs, allowing clients to experience a building before it is built. Scientists can use VR to visualize complex data sets, such as molecular structures or astronomical phenomena, gaining new insights and understanding. Even abstract concepts, such as mathematical equations or philosophical ideas, can be given form and substance in a virtual environment, making them more accessible and engaging.
